The Importance of Flu Vaccination for Dialysis Patients
Individuals undergoing dialysis are particularly vulnerable to severe complications from influenza. Their compromised immune systems make them less able to fight off infection, and the flu can exacerbate existing health conditions. That’s why proactive measures, like vaccination, are so critical.

Why a quadrivalent Vaccine?
The choice of a quadrivalent vaccine is a strategic one. historically, trivalent vaccines (protecting against three strains) were standard. However, the inclusion of an additional influenza B strain in quadrivalent vaccines has been shown to improve protection rates, especially during seasons where B strains are dominant. this is crucial for dialysis patients, where even a mild case of the flu can lead to serious health setbacks.
Understanding the Risks for Dialysis Patients
Dialysis patients face a unique set of challenges when it comes to influenza. Their immune systems are frequently enough weakened by kidney disease and the dialysis process itself. this makes them more susceptible to infection and less responsive to vaccines. Furthermore, the flu can worsen kidney function and increase the risk of hospitalization and even death.
According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C),people with chronic medical conditions like kidney disease are at higher risk of serious complications from the flu. Vaccination is the most effective way to protect these individuals.
